Db2 priekškompilatora priekškompilators Datorzinātnē priekšprocesors (vai priekškompilators) ir programma, kas apstrādā savus ievades datus, lai iegūtu izvadi, ko izmanto kā ievadi citai programmai. Tiek uzskatīts, ka izvade ir iepriekš apstrādāta ievades datu forma, ko bieži izmanto dažas turpmākās programmas, piemēram, kompilatori. https://en.wikipedia.org › wiki › Priekšapstrādātājs
Pirmapstrādātājs - Wikipedia
skenē programmu un kopē visus SQL priekšrakstus un resursdatora mainīgā informāciju DBRM (datu bāzes pieprasījuma modulī). Iepriekšējais kompilators atgriež arī avota kodu, kas ir modificēts tā, lai SQL priekšraksti neizraisītu kļūdas, kad jūs kompilējat programmu.
Kas ir COBOL DB2 pirmskompilācijas procedūra?
Pirmskompilācija ir process, kura laikā COBOL-DB2 programmā izmantotie SQL priekšraksti tiek aizstāti ar atbilstošiem COBOL izsaukumiem. Iepriekšēja kompilācija ir nepieciešama pirms faktiskās kompilācijas, jo COBOL kompilators nevar atpazīt DB2 SQL priekšrakstus un to dēļ radīs kļūdas.
Kas ir priekškompilācijas procesa rezultāts?
DB2 priekškompilācijas process, izmantojot DB2 priekškompilatoru.
Tas ģenerē divus izvadus (t.i., modificēto avota kodu un datu bāzes pieprasījuma moduli (DBRM)). Modificēts avota kods ir kompilēta un saišu rediģēšana kā vienkārša COBOL programma, jo tam nav SQL priekšrakstu.
Kas ir saistīšanas process?
Izveidojas saistīšanas process attiecības starp lietojumprogrammu un tās relāciju datiem. Šis process ir nepieciešams, pirms varat izpildīt programmu. … Pirms programmas palaišanas modificētais pirmkods ir jāapkopo un jārediģē ar saiti. DBRM ir jāsaista ar pakotni.
Kas ir ievade saistīšanas procesam?
Kāda ir saistīšanas procesa ievade? DBRM ir saistīšanas procesa ievade, kas tiek iegūta iepriekšējas kompilēšanas darbībā.